LOCATION
The hotel was built in 1913, allegedly at the instigation of King Frederik VIII. The Copenhagen Plaza is in the heart of Copenhagen and looks out at Tivoli itself, right opposite the Central Station with all its local and domestic connections and just 12 minutes from the airport. Denmark's King Frederik VIII commissioned the Plaza to be built in 1913 and since then the hotel has been the home away from home for many visitors to Copenhagen. The Copenhagen Plaza Hotel is situated in the very heart of Copenhagen's lively shopping, dining and entertainment area.
ACCOMMODATION
The Copenhagen Plaza has 93 rooms, most of which are different. The rooms are luxuriously and tastefully fitted out, taking into consideration each room's architecture and original interior. All modern conveniences are provided, including high-speed Internet connection. 2 floors are reserved for non-smokers. TV is on a pay per view basis.
FACILITIES Experience the famous "Library" bar and the unique environment of the "Flora Danica" restaurant. The sports and fitness centre is open 24 hours a day and there is parking nearby.
